East Coast Meet 'N Greet: Englishtown NJ, August 26th & 27th

Hi everyone. I wanted to invite all of you here at 300CForums to the 2005 East Coast Meet 'N Greet. This event is for all 300C, Magnum and Charger owners and enthusiasts and will take place at Englishtown Raceway in Englishtown, New Jersey.

2005 East Coast LX Meet 'N Greet


The East Coast Meet 'n Greet will take place Friday night, August 26th and Saturday, August 27th for those that can come out either for one or both days. We're scheduled to have our own staging lanes at Englishtown Raceway for those that want to try their hand at the quarter mile and we'll have our own pit/pavillion area so we all will have a point to congregate and relax and have a good time. We do not expect everyone to want to race their cars so please don't not come become this is at a track.

The schedule of events:

Friday Night:
Drag Night at Etown, 6pm to 10pm (gates open at 5pm)
Afterwards, Food/Cocktails at a local sports bar for those that are interested
A good night's sleep at a local hotel (optional, we recommend Holiday Inn, see below)

Saturday:
Official Meet 'n Greet, 10am to ? at Englishtown Raceway
Drag Racing, 9:30am to ? (gates open at 8:30 am)
Lunch Provided by HHP

Requirements For Racers:

In order to race, cars must have mufflers and seat belts (draining the coolant is not required) and drivers must wear helmets (full-face Snell-approved for cars under 13.5s in the 1/4 mile). They do rent helmets at the track for three or four dollars so you don't need to go out and buy one if you don't already have one. Also, racers must wear long pants, a shirt with sleeves (t-shirt) and shoes are a must (no flip flops or sandals). You must be at least 17 years old to race but if you are 17, you must have a parent present to sign the waiver.

Admission Prices at Etown:

Friday Night:
$20.00 to race
$10.00 to spectate
Saturday:
$25.00 to race
$12.00 to spectate

For the quality of Etown Raceway, these prices are very reasonable and I think everyone is going to be impressed by the entire facility. Englishtown will be providing us with the tents, tables and chairs so that we will be able to have our own pit area and we will have our own staging lanes for those that wish to race.

HHP will be providing lunch which will be probably be your choice from Englishtown Raceway's own tasty menu. We will have drinks, too. If you want Beer, it would be BYOB but NO glass bottles of any kind, and they allow no alcohol in the stands, too. I was told that Englishtown Raceway does have their own beer garden. We'll all now get to see where beer grows.

Rain Date:
If for some reason the weather does not cooperate for us, the rain date will be for sometime in October due to the heavy schedule at the track. We'll tackle this obstacle as needed.
